A Guide to Perennial Care for Vibrant Gardens

Cultivating a vibrant perennial garden requires easy care and attention. These hardy plants reward you with beautiful blooms year after year, adding joy to your landscape. To ensure your perennials thrive, implement these essential tips.

  • Choose your perennials in a location that receives the ideal amount of sunlight for their needs.
  • Water your perennials regularly, especially during dry periods.
  • Nourish your plants with a balanced fertilizer in the growing season.

Choosing the Right Trees and Shrubs for Your Climate

Creating a thriving landscape starts with choosing trees and shrubs that can survive in your specific climate. A crucial step is identifying your region's hardiness zone. This reveals the average minimum winter temperatures your plants can endure. Check a reliable online resource or regional nursery for accurate knowledge about your hardiness zone.

  • Next, evaluate the amount of sunlight your yard receives. Choose trees and shrubs that are appropriate to full sun, partial shade, or full shade conditions.
  • Soil type is also crucial. Analyze if your soil is sandy and adjust your plant choices accordingly.
  • Lastly, think about the overall aesthetic you want to design.

By thoroughly considering these factors, you can effectively cultivate a thriving landscape that will appreciate for generations to come.
